How to send data from your phone via
Bluetooth
You can send data via Bluetooth by running a
corresponding application, rather than from the
Bluetooth menu as with normal mobile phones.
Sending pictures: Open the Gallery
application and select a picture. Then tap
Menu > Share > Bluetooth. If Bluetooth is
off, tap Bluetooth to turn it on. A checkmark
indicates the function is active. Then tap
Scan for devices and choose the device you
want to send data from the list.
Exporting contacts: Open the Contacts
application. Tap the contact you want to
share. Tap the Menu Key
Bluetooth. If Bluetooth is off, tap Bluetooth
to turn it on. A checkmark indicates the
function is active. Then tap Scan for devices
and choose the device you want to send
data from the list.
